Description
ST LEVAN TRETHEWEY SW 32 SE 7/260 Barns and adjoining outbuildings at - approximately 50 metres west of Trewey Farmhouse GV II Barns and adjoining outbuildings; front building on the left is converted from former house. Probably some C18 walls, otherwise circa mid C19 and circa 1870 (date on roof plaster). Granite rubble with granite dressings. Mostly scantle slate roofs with gable ends except for half-hipped end of front wing on the right. Plan: Large U-shaped plan. Former probably C18 house now single-storey on the left with circa mid-C19 barn with axial threshing floor behind. Principal 1870 range adjoins rear right-hand side of older barn and returns in front on the right. In front of this is a single-storey waggon shed. Exterior: 2-storey barns, single-storey former house in front on the left and single-storey waggon shed in front on the right. Virtually unaltered elevations. Principal barn front has 3 ground floor doorways and 2 windows flanking central doorway. Loading doorway over right-hand doorway, 3 regularly spaced first floor windows. Older barn front, returning on the left, has 2 doorways (middle and right) and a loading doorway to threshing floor over; 1 ground floor window (left) and 2 first floor windows above. Many old ledged doors, some original shuttered windows. Interior has lime-washed walls and original roof structures.
